I did try one of those veggie burgers that are sold in packaging boxes in the freezer section of a grocery store, long ago. Years ago.
Some friends were trying them out of curiosity . So they offered me one. What the heck....I eat veggies in their natural form ....just as long as there were no weird unknown ingredients in it. Looked like hamburger and cooked in a skillet like one. It tasted similar to very lean meat...but still carried a bland taste. It sure didn't have that filling feel of the protein with substance and fat mixed in , as the real thing. The feeling that fills you and keeps you working in sub zero winters....
Interestingly, in a few minutes it seemed as I had nothing at all of substance , and felt I needed to eat all over again. I suppose nowadays those can be mixed with coconut oil, or other veggie based oil to replace the fat protein content, but I haven't had another since .
